  2. Regen also has no defence - all it has are its heals - and in my experience they don't heal enough if you don't use them all. DP and IH are not perma and are end-heavy - Siphon Life is an excellent fill-in tool for the down times and for the mobs that don't force you to fire up IH or DP if you need to save them for the Elite Boss around the corner.

    Its only 2 extra slots in FH. In my opinion you save that just by avoiding Fly.

    In my experience, Regen is great fun to play but its not all that. You don't heal faster than they can hurt you and your end does drain away. It's your toon, but I still say you skip health and end boosts at your peril.
  3. Why drop Siphon Life? It's a great tool if you slot it properly - it damages foes whilst lowering their accuracy and at the same time it adds to your health. What's not to like? I use it as one of Maxigirl's primary attacks, and it's served her very well indeed for 43 levels. If you want to drop an attack, get rid of Shadow Punch. You shouldn't need to take that at lvl 20.

    And why take slots from Fast Healing? I'd leave them in.

    Soul Drain is marvellous - DM 's accuracy can be tragically poor, so slot SD for recharges and To Hit buffs.

    Dark Consumption is good, but I went the Swift/Health/Stamina route so don't feel the need to exploit it as a primary attack/source of endurance yet. It will aggro mobs, but costs nothing but time to activate.

    Personally I prefer the Leaping to the Flight pool for this build. Combat Jumping is a much needed extra defensive power, and you don't need Air Superiority - as good as it is - with the other attacks you can call on. Also, Superjump is less slot-hungry, faster, and way cooler than Fly And you can still use it to take out Skiffs in Terra Volta and Striga

    For the future, at 32 I heartily recommend Midnight Grasp and at 41 Focused Accuracy from the Body Mastery epic pool. Slot FA 3/3 with end redux/To Hit buffs, and you can save the Accuracy SOs in all your other attacks - the only accuracy SO i keep is in Siphon Life, along with 1 or 2 recharges (I can't remember which ), 1 heal, and the rest damage; I hardly ever miss with that, and with Soul Drain going I can repair damage fast while swatting bosses.
